Jharkhand CM announces appointment of 25,000 teachers, Rs 4 lakh insurance for death in natural calamity

CM inaugurates Sarkar Apke Dwar program at Giridih

Ranchi, October 12: Chief minister Hemant  Soren announced the appointment of 25,000 teachers while launching the program ‘Aapki Yojana, Aapki Sarkar, Aapke Dwar’ at Jhanda Maidan in Giridih on Wednesday.

Along with this, Soren talked about giving four lakh rupees to the families of the migrant laborers and their families on the accidental death.

While inaugurating the state’s ambitious ‘Aapki Yojana, Aapki Sarkar-Aapke Dwar’ program from Jhanda Maidan in Giridih on Wednesday, the Chief Minister made several big announcements. Under this, where 25 thousand teachers will soon be appointed in the state, on the accidental death of the migrant laborers, it has been said that Rs 4 lakh will be given to their families. Apart from this, if people across the state die due to snakebite, elephant killing, drowning in water or other calamity, then the government will give Rs 4 lakh as compensation to the families of such people.

On this occasion, CM inaugurated four schemes and laid the foundation stone of 57 schemes. At the same time, assets were also distributed among more than 22 thousand beneficiaries worth over Rs 900 crores.  

Soren said that it has been decided from the Jharkhand cabinet to move forward to solve the  problem of mica industry.

“Very soon work will be seen towards establishing the business system of Mica industry by declaring it as an industry,” said Soren.

Hemant Soren also launched Savitri Bai Phule Kishori Yojana for the girl child. When these girls will be 18 years old, Rs 40,000 would be given to each of them.

“Model schools are being built in every district. That government school will prove to be better than the private school in the state. Our effort is to start those schools from the next session.
